COVID-19: Osun Grants Amnesty to 26 Prison Inmates

The Chief Judge of Osun State, Justice Oyebola Ojo, has freed twenty six (26) awaiting trial inmates from Ilesa and Ile-Ife Medium Security Custodial Centres. Fourteen (14) of the inmates were released from Ile-Ife and twelve (12) from Ilesa.

Freedom for these inmates, came on the heels of the concerted efforts being put in place by the Federal and State governments to decongest Custodial Centres in curbing the spread of deadly novel coronavirus pandemic (Covid-19)

They were released during the Chief Judge’s special visit to the Custodial Centres which started from Ilesa Custodial Centre on Wednesday, 27th of May, and ended at Ile-Ife Custodial Centre, on Thursday, 28th May, 2020.

In his welcome address, the Controller of Corrections Osun State Command, Segun Oluwasemire, appreciated the CJ and her team for the special visit to the facilities in finding time out of their busy schedules even at this dreaded period of Covid-19.

He assured the gathering of his unwavering resolve and that of his officers and men, not to falter in the discharge of the NCoS’ mandates of reformation, rehabilitation and reintegration. Not leaving out the newly added mandate of non-custodial measures.

The Controller later charged the released inmates to be of good behaviour and put to good use all vocational trainings and knowledge acquired while in custody. He urged them to be the best in their future endeavours. “Be good examples in the larger society.” He also encouraged them to contribute their quotas positively to end the Covid-19 pandemic.

In separate remarks, officers in charge of Ilesa and Ile-Ife Custodial Centres, Johnbull Saudje and Babatunde Ajani, respectively, who are Deputy Controllers of Corrections(DCC). Pleaded with the Chief Judge, to make the visit, a quarterly exercise. As the benefits derived from it administratively, cannot be overemphasised.

Highlights of the visit were: Holding of special court sessions specifically for the delivery of judgements on pending cases before some judges of the state high Court. The presentation of portrait of the Chief Judge, painted by an inmate of Ilesa Custodial Centre to the CJ by the Controller of Corrections.

The dignitaries at the visits were the Osun state Attorney General and Commissioner for Justice, Barr. Femi Akande, the officials of the Directorate of Public Prosecution(DPP) and Legal Aid Council of Nigeria (LACoN). Members of Nigeria Bar Association (NBA), Ilesa, Ife and Iwo branches.
